Kilograms are a measure of mass, not weight. Weight, in the metric system, is measured in Newtons. That said, kilograms are often used as the metric equivalent of pounds in common discourse. This can be done because the vast majority of measurements are made at the surface of the Earth, where the force of gravity is essentially constant. In that sense, there are 2.2 pounds in one kilogram, so a 3 pound bag of apples is a 1.36 kilo bag of apples

There are about 4 small apples, 3 medium apples, or 2 large apples in a pound.
There are 0.45359237 kilograms in one pound. Therefore to get amount of pounds in kilograms, value in kilograms has to be divided by amount of kilograms in one pound: 4486 kilograms = [kilograms] / 0.45359237 = 4486 / 0.45359237 = 9889.9371 pounds
